Getting immediate feedback from clients through direct outbound contact is a powerful strategy for businesses aiming to enhance their customer experience and improve their products or services. Direct outreach allows companies to gather valuable insights in real-time, ensuring they stay attuned to customer needs, preferences, and expectations. The process of actively seeking feedback demonstrates a commitment to continuous improvement and fosters a sense of trust and transparency with clients. Outbound contact, such as phone calls, emails, or even text messages, enables businesses to engage clients on a more personal level. This personalized approach often leads to more honest and constructive feedback, as customers feel their voices are being heard and valued. By asking the right questions, businesses can uncover pain points, identify areas for improvement, and assess customer satisfaction with greater accuracy.

In turn, this information can be used to make informed decisions about product development, customer service enhancements, or adjustments to business strategies. The immediate nature of direct outbound contact ensures that feedback is received while the customer’s experience is still fresh in their mind. This can be especially important when seeking feedback after a purchase or a service interaction. Clients are more likely to provide detailed and specific insights when the experience is still vivid, which can lead to more actionable data for the business. Immediate feedback also helps businesses respond quickly to any issues, addressing concerns before they escalate into larger problems that could affect customer retention or brand reputation. In addition to improving the quality of products and services, gathering feedback through outbound contact strengthens the relationship between businesses and their clients. Clients appreciate businesses that take the time to reach out and ask for their opinions, which can foster greater loyalty and engagement.
Regular communication through feedback requests also keeps customers connected to the brand, making them feel like valued partners in the company’s success. This ongoing dialogue helps build long-term relationships based on mutual trust and respect. Moreover, direct outbound feedback provides an opportunity for businesses to demonstrate their commitment to customer satisfaction. By acting on the feedback received, companies can show clients that their opinions are not only heard but also acted upon. This can be a key differentiator in a competitive market, where clients often have many options to choose from.
